Car
If you're driving from central Punggol, head west on Punggol Way. Continue onto Punggol Central, then turn left onto Punggol Field. Follow Punggol Field until you reach the junction with Punggol Drive. Turn right onto Punggol Drive, and continue until you see the signs for TPE (Tampines Expressway). Merge onto the TPE and take exit 2 towards SLE (Seletar Expressway). Follow the signs for Yishun and merge onto Yishun Ave 1. Continue straight until you reach Island Club Rd, where Rotunda is located at 180 Island Club Rd, Singapore 578774. Parking may be available on-site, but be prepared for possible charges.
Public Transportation
To reach Rotunda using public transportation, start by taking the MRT to Punggol MRT Station (NE17). From there, exit the station and head to the bus interchange. Board bus number 84, which will take you towards Yishun. Stay on the bus until you reach the stop at the junction of Island Club Road. From the bus stop, it's a short walk south along Island Club Road to reach Rotunda at 180 Island Club Rd, Singapore 578774. Note that bus fares typically range from SGD 1.00 to SGD 2.00 depending on the distance.
